Tesla CEO Elon Musk recently bought the social media microblogging platform Twitter for a whopping $44 billion. Since then, people across the globe are tagging the richest man on the planet in their tweets and are asking him to buy various brands and fix their issues.

Gujarat Titans opener Shubman Gill also joined the bandwagon recently. The rising star of Indian cricket took to Twitter on Friday (April 29) and made a request to Musk to buy the food delivery app Swiggy "as they are not delivering on time".

Gill’s post went viral in no time. Subsequently, netizens and a fake account of Swiggy trolled the young batter for his child-like request.

Meanwhile, responding to Gill’s tweet, Swiggy from its original Twitter account wrote, “Hi Shubman Gill. Twitter or no Twitter, we just want to make sure all is well with your orders (that is if you’re ordering). Meet us in DM with your details, we’ll jump on it quicker than any acquisition.”
